Ticket: Config drift on imgcache-prod nodes

While chasing the memory leak in the Pixelbin image cache, we found three prod nodes running hand-edited eviction settings that diverged from the Halvard baseline. The drift masks the leak on some hosts and amplifies it on others, making heap profiles inconsistent. Requesting security review since edits bypassed change control. Nodes should be reconciled to the baseline below:

deployment values, kajep-kageg:
[praix]
host = praix.paliqcorp.corp
user = praix_svc
database = praix_prod

Welcome to the WaveGlimpse team! The audio waveform preview is rendered server-side by our peak-extraction service, Crestline, then cached as SVG tiles. Future maintainers: don't regenerate tiles on every seek — the cache key includes sample rate and zoom level, so hits should be ~95%. If previews look jagged, Crestline's downsampler config probably drifted. You can poke Crestline directly from your dev box once you're set up. Calls to its admin endpoint authenticate with the key that follows.

gateway credential: kto3_qfe

Handover — Gross-Margin Review

From Director Ilsa Crane to Director Pavel Norr.

Status: review two-thirds complete. Branches Welton and Farr show margin slippage on the Corvette-line accessories; pricing fix drafted, not yet approved. Supplier renegotiation with Tarnow Fabrication pending. Branch managers briefed on data submissions only. Deadline unchanged. Final item requires discretion before distribution.

management briefing: The pricing group signed off on a budget of $378.8 million for Project Kasael.